Obstetrics and Gynecology (East 80th Street)

The Obstetrics and Gynecology division brings together a highly trained and specialized team of physicians, nurses and clinicians to provide the most comprehensive healthcare services for every stage in a woman's life; from adolescence through childbearing to menopause and the post-menopausal years.

With an eye toward the emotional well-being of our patients, our practitioners create a warm, supportive and comforting environment for women. We also encourage our patients to be informed about their healthcare needs and to participate in their own care and treatment.

Endocrine Oncology Care

The Endocrine Oncology Center at Weill Cornell Medicine offers high-quality, personalized treatment for patients with endocrine tumors of the thyroid, parathyroid, adrenal gland, gastrointestinal tract and pancreas. Our expert team of surgeons, nurses and staff ensure patients experience the best care possible and treatment that meets their unique needs.
